Abstract

The invention relates to an arc-shaped surface thermoplastic mould and a processing method utilizing the mould to produce micro-corrugated straw veneers. The arc-shaped surface thermoplastic mould comprises an upper mould, a lower mould and a base, the upper mould and the lower mould are mutually matched and adaptive in shape, the lower mould is disposed on the base and supported by the same, and gap passages for saturated hot steam to pass are reserved between the inner surface and the outer surface of the lower mould. The processing method utilizing the mould to produce the micro-corrugated straw veneers includes the steps: (1) pretreating raw materials; (2) performing fiber coating; (3) spreading coated fibers; (4) performing thermal briquetting for the spread materials to form plane veneers; (5) performing thermal plastifying for the surfaces of the plane veneers; and (6) enabling the plane veneers to be micro-corrugated. The mould and the processing method have the advantages that gluing thickness of the surfaces of the veneers is uniform, so that in a multi-layer board production process, gluing quality between the veneers is improved greatly, micro corrugations between two adjacent veneers are mutually pressed into base materials of each other, integrity is improved, performances in various aspects of boards are improved, and particularly grasping force of straw boards to screws is increased.

Description

Technical field [0001] The invention relates to a man-made board manufacturing technology, in particular to a thermoplastic mold with a curved surface and a processing method for producing a micro-corrugated straw veneer by using the mold. Background technique [0002] At present, in the technical field of wood-based panels, the method of manufacturing straw multi-layer boards is to process straws into veneers, and then press them into blanks through a certain process. The veneer needs to be evenly applied to a certain thickness before glue pressing, which is a necessary condition to ensure the bonding strength between the veneers of each layer. There are still two problems in the straw multi-layer board produced by traditional technology: [0003] 1) The bonding quality between the veneers is poor, and it is easy to crack from the interface during use.
